AJ12 BTE is a 2012 Toyota Avensis in Grey with a 1,998c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 92.3%.
Across all 2012 Toyota Avensis models, the average MOT pass rate is 81.5% with a typical mileage of 82,470 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Toyota Avensis f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 106,316 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AJ12 BTE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Toyota Avensis typ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 14 years old, this Toyota Avensis is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
